- The distance between Wakeeney, Ks, Usa and Aledo, Il, Usa is approximately 798 km or 496 mi.
- To reach Wakeeney, Ks in this distance one would set out from Aledo, Il bearing 256.8°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Wakeeney, Ks bearing 251° or WSW .
- Wakeeney, Ks has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Aledo, Il has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Wakeeney, Ks is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Aledo, Il is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 1.3 °C (2.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.8 °C (3.2°F) less in Wakeeney, Ks. The continentality subtype is truly continental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 322.2 mm (12.7 in) less which is equivalent to 322.2 l/m² (7.91 US gal/ft²) or 3,222,000 l/ha (344,453 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2° higher in Wakeeney, Ks than in Aledo, Il.
